DF Stratify Documentation Page 5 of 13 Copyright 1998 2003 ARTS PDF ify 1 1 a r t S ARTS PDF Stratify www artspdf com 4 0 Using ARTS PDF Stratify 4 1 Launching ARTS PDF Stratify m To use the software launch ARTS PDF Stratify using the E button on the Acrobat toolbar ARTS PDF Stratify will then display its layers dialog box 4 2 Usage Notes Often designers create documents in layout applications such as Quark Express Adobe InDesign or Adobe PageMaker which include layered information But how does one transfer this layered knowledge to a PDF document The problem is that there is currently no support for layers in the PostScript files that Adobe Acrobat Distiller uses to create the PDF documents There are two basic ways to create layers using ARTS PDF Stratify These are 1 In the layout application output complete pages and use these when creating the PDF document The PDF will have pages containing all the required objects Then use ARTS PDF Stratify s Layers and Elements options to create layers and add objects to them and 2 Alternatively from the layout application you can output layers individually distill and combine into a single PDF document Then use ARTS PDF Stratify s Convert pages to layers option to make a new page with layers It is recommended that significant amounts of new information can be added first to the document as a new PDF page and then as a layer to a page using ARTS PDF St

7. al select next time Acrobat is launched k Select text runs k Group text in batch mode 4 3 2 Allow partial select This determines whether objects will be selected when only a part of the image is touched by the ARTS PDF Stratify object select tool If this is off unchecked the entire object must fall within the selection rectangle in order to be selected 4 3 3 Select text runs Acrobat returns all text in a stream that appears consecutively as a single text object Each of these objects is divided up into things called text runs Select text runs here means that when you select text objects you are actually selecting the text runs instead of the whole object This allows the user to assign the text runs of the text object to different layers If this is not checked then the text object will be basically considered a single text object 4 3 4 Group text in batch mode Essentially batch mode for selecting text runs When the Convert pages to layers is chosen from the ARTS PDF Stratify menu on the Acrobat toolbar this function determines whether text runs will be converted as a single text object or broken up into text runs Unless there is a need to maintain the ability to select text as objects it is very much desirable to do it this way ARTS PDF Stratify Documentation Page 7 of 13 Copyright O 1998 2003 ARTS PDF www artspdf com 44 The ARTS PDF Stratify Window ARTS PDF Stratify 1 1 This window allows t

10. l number of objects currently selected ARTS PDF Stratify Documentation Page 9 of 13 Copyright O 1998 2003 ARTS PDF tratify 1 1 a r t S ARTS PDF Stratify www artspdf com 4 5 Selecting Objects The ARTS PDF Stratify object selection tool hs can be used to select objects to be added to a layer s removed from a layer s or manipulated using one of the forward backward options from the ARTS PDF Stratify tools menu There are several methods for selecting objects When an object is selected a dotted line will appear around it As objects are selected the number of objects currently selected will appear in the ARTS PDF Stratify window in the Selection section MX Objects may be added to more than one layer If an object is assigned to more than one layer and any of those layers are set to Show in the ARTS PDF Stratify window then the object will be displayed in the Acrobat viewer 4 5 1 Selecting Single Objects Simply click on an object in the PDF document to select it 4 5 2 Selecting Multiple Objects Multiple objects can be selected in two ways One is to click on a single object then hold down the Shift key while clicking on additional objects The second method is to use drag select This is done by moving the object selection tool onto the PDF page then dragging it to create a rectangle around all objects the user wishes to select 4 5 3 Selecting Stacked Objects Occasionally smaller object
